  4. Manuel Leuterio de Castro Jr. (born July 6, 1949), better known as Noli de Castro or "Kabayan" Noli de Castro, is a Filipino journalist, anchorman and politician. He was elected to the Senate of the Philippines in 2001 after receiving the most votes of any Senator in the 2001 election.     Jun 15, 2024 · Noli de Castro is a Filipino journalist, news anchor, and politician. He has served as the 12th Vice President of the Philippines, and Chairman of the Housing and Urban Development Coordinating Council, both, from June 30, 2004 to June 30, 2010, and as Senator of the Philippines, from June 30, 2001 to June 30, 2004.
